Bash Qaleh Rural District (Persian: دهستان باشقلعه)[5] is in the Central District of Urmia County, West Azerbaijan province, Iran.[6] Its capital is the village of Yurqunabad-e Olya.[3]
Demographics
Population
At the time of the 2006 National Census, the rural district's population was 9,862 in 2,681 households.[7] There were 9,994 inhabitants in 2,830 households at the following census of 2011.[8] The 2016 census measured the population of the rural district as 10,043 in 3,033 households. The most populous of its 47 villages was Tupraq Qaleh, with 2,467 people.[4]
